Chapter 785: A FAMILY BRUNCH

Although Misha wasn't too happy about Kia meeting his parents, he still felt this was the right time to let them know that he was in a relationship and make them stop fussing over his marriage.

And maybe this was a way to bring Kia and his family closer, which was a good idea, maybe Kia would open her heart more.

If he couldn't get close to Kia, maybe his overly cheerful and sometimes annoying father or his wise and affectionate mother could make Kia feel much more comfortable.

With that in mind, Misha finished his bath and quickly put on a casual t-shirt and a pair of denim pants, while Kia was on the phone with Keira. He couldn't hear what they were talking about, because they were talking in low voices and when he got closer and Kia saw him, she immediately ended the phone call and approached Misha.

From the look on her face Misha could tell she was frantic. There was a fine line between her eyebrows, indicating that she wasn't in a good mood.

"Let's go," said Kia, before Misha could ask what was wrong with her. She avoided the question, thus, Misha didn't ask and followed her out of the room.

On the way to the restaurant where his parents were waiting, Kia didn't say anything. She just kept quiet and seemed to be busy with her own thoughts.

"Over here," Misha said while pulling Kia's hand, because she almost missed the entrance of the restaurant, proving that she had been daydreaming since earlier, but Misha didn't mention it.

This restaurant's roof was shaped like a dome and was made of glass. There were several plants and trees here and there, which seemed to be the concept of this restaurant with a garden theme.

Because that was what this restaurant looked like.

At a table for four, waiting for them were Mr. and Mrs. Tordoff. The two of them were chatting casually and laughing quietly, but as soon as they saw Kia and Misha approaching they stopped talking and smiled very happily while raising their hands, indicating their position, even though Kia and Misha had seen the two of them already.

Both of them seemed very excited to see their son with a woman.

"Come here, sit here," said Candice, Misha's mother. She looked very beautiful even though she was no longer young, her face looked radiant when she pulled Kia's hand to sit beside her.

And Kia felt welcomed by these two people, they seemed very happy when they saw her and it was an unusual thing for Kia to find someone so happy to see her, especially when the person barely knew her.

So far, only Mika had been so happy when she saw herself coming home and greeted her enthusiastically.

"Have you eaten?" asked Candice with concern.

"You must be starving because he woke up so late, you should have just splashed some water on his face to wake him up quickly," commented Lexus as he glanced at his son and gave him a disapproving look.

Kia just smiled, because she wasn't used to being in such a warm environment and being treated as if she was an important figure.

She wasn't used to feeling this way and it made her a little uncomfortable. Not that they treated her badly, but quite the opposite.

Because apparently, unconsciously, Kia expected that she would be ignored again when they were having a meal together like this, as she usually would be.

Kia didn't even remember the last time she was noticed when she was with her family.

They would discuss the development of Alia's disease and how great she was because she had bravely gone through the whole process of the treatment or how Daniel won a championship and what his achievements were.

But when it came to Kia, they had nothing to say. They would only think that she existed, but were not really aware of her existence.

If there was something wrong with their food or with the house, then they would look for her because it was as if it was Kia's responsibility, a young girl who wasn't even twenty years old.

"Try this dish, I tried it last night and it's really good," Candice said enthusiastically, but this only made Kia more nervous, because she wasn't used to getting this kind of attention.

"What is it? Did you guys fight?" asked Lexus when he saw Kia looking a little tense. "Did my son force you to do something?"

"If someone likes to force people, it's you father," said Misha while drinking his coffee casually. "You're pushing your way through this brunch."

Kia, who heard that, immediately glared fiercely at Misha and kicked his leg, then looked at Candice and Lexus' faces carefully, she didn't want them to misunderstand Misha's comments.

For a moment, Candice and Lexus were silent and this made Kia feel her heart stop beating for a beat, because she thought they would assume she was completely clueless and start thinking negatively about her.

Kia was indeed uncomfortable with the attention they were giving, but that didn't mean she wanted to be rude to them or she didn't like this meeting, even though she couldn't be said to be happy.

Ugh! Kia felt herself wanting to go back to her room and snuggle under the covers hugging Mika, hiding from the world.

It was an exaggerated reaction and Kia realized it…

But, a moment later, Lexus and Candice started laughing lightly and the middle-aged woman even patted her on the shoulder gently.

"You don't need to be too tense," she said softly, while clasping Kia's hand. "Think of it as just an ordinary shared meal, like a family meal, we won't ask questions that make you feel uncomfortable and if you don't want to answer any of them, that's fine too."

Candice used her motherly voice and this only made Kia feel even more bitter. Eating with family? They had no idea what kinds of 'meals with the family' she had gone through.
